When using your Ego8, you may wish to change the velocity
at which your Ego8 is firing. This is done by inserting a 1/8" hex
key into the adjuster screw at the bottom of your Ego8 Inline
Regulator and adjusting it accordingly (See Figure 6.1). By
turning this adjuster screw clockwise you decrease the output
pressure of the Inline Regulator and consequently the velocity,
by turning the adjuster screw counter clockwise you increase
the output pressure of the Inline Regulator and consequently
the velocity.

USING YOUR EGO8

note: After each adjustment fire two clearing shots to
gain an accurate velocity reading. never exceed 300fps.

The OFF ROF parameter is used to control how fast the Ego8
cycles when the Break-Beam Sensor System is disabled. This
parameter can be set between 4.0 and 15.0 balls per second and
should always be set to the slowest speed of the loading system
in use.

First shot drop off is a reduction in velocity of the first shot fired
after an extended period of not firing and is caused by the
stiction between dynamic o-rings and the surfaces that they are
in contact with. In order to compensate for FSDO this parameter
can be set to add extra time to the DWELL parameter for the
first shot. This parameter can be set
between 0.0 and 3.0 milliseconds.

40.

THE DWELL
parameter (dwell)
The Dwell parameter sets the amount of time that the solenoid
is energized and therefore the amount of gas that is released
with each shot of the Ego8. Setting this parameter too low will
result in low velocity shots and/or excessive
shot to shot velocity fluctuations. Setting the
parameter too high will simply waste gas and
make the Ego8 louder.
The DWELL can be set between 0.0 and 25.0
milliseconds. The factory default setting can
normally be reduced after a few thousand
shots as the Ego8 ‘beds-in’.

The TRAININ parameter is used to select Training Mode. In
Training Mode the Ego8 will function exactly the same as normal
but with two important differences:1. The solenoid valve is under - driven so that the rammer only
moves a small amount and does not strike the exhaust valve. This
simulates the firing cycle without wasting air and generating
lots of noise.
2. The BBSS is overridden so that the Ego8 can cycle without
paint. The centre of the BBSS indicator changes to a ‘T’ to indicate
that Training Mode is enabled.

The Ego8 is fitted with a dual trigger pull detection system. A
non - contact opto-electronic trigger sensor arrangement is used
to detect trigger movement whilst a micro - switch is used to
provide a more traditional tactile feedback for the trigger. The
TRIGGER parameter is used to select which system is used. The
choices available are as follows:>
>
	
>
	

OPTO: Select the Opto sensor for trigger pull detection
SWITCH: Select the microswitch for trigger pull 		
detection
CANCEL: Cancel editing and leave the parameter 		
unchanged

This parameter controls the amount of power used by the Break
Beam Sensor System and should normally be left on it’s default
low power setting. However scratches on the surface of either of
the sensors, or the use of some third party sensors, may require
that the BBSS power level be increased. Higher power levels will
cause more drain on the battery. The choices available for this
parameter are:-

This parameter controls the amount of power used by the
pneumatic solenoid and should normally be left at it’s default
low power setting. Cold weather (sub - zero degress Celcius)
will cause lubricants to thicken and increase stiction in the
system which may cause velocity drop - off and/or shot to shot
inconsistancy. Increasing the solenoid power will often help to
eliminate these problems however the higher power level will
cause more drain on the battery. The choices available for the
paramater are:>
>
>
	

LO POWER: Low power solenoid drive
HI POWER: High power solenoid drive
CANCEL: Cancel editing and leave the parameter 		
unchanged
